Louis BOURASSA was born 23 February 1708 in Lauzon, Lévis, Canada, New France

Louis BOURASSA was the child of Jean BOURASSA   and   Françoise METHOT and the grandchild of: (paternal)  Jean BOURASSA and Perrette-Marie VALLEE (maternal)  Abraham METHOT and Marie-Madeleine MEZERAY dite NOPCES

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Louis  married  Marie-Françoise BOUCHER 28 April 1732 in Saint-Nicolas, Lévis, Canada, New France .  The couple had (at least) 10 children.
Marie-Françoise BOUCHER  was born 31 August 1710 in Saint-Nicolas, Lévis, Québec, Canada .  Marie-Françoise died 13 October 1778 in Saint-Nicolas, Lévis, Québec, Canada .  Marie-Françoise was the child of Ignace BOUCHER and Marie-Françoise POUILLOT.

Louis BOURASSA died 27 June 1751 in Saint-Nicolas, Lévis, Canada, New France .

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
